Road cycling around Marienrachdorf offers varied terrain through Germany's Westerwald district. The region features green forests and rolling hills, providing diverse gradients for cyclists. Routes often follow idyllic rivers like the Nister, enhancing the scenic experience. This landscape supports a range of road cycling routes, from moderate paths to more challenging rides with significant elevation gains.

There are over 140 road cycling routes available around Marienrachdorf, offering a wide range of options for different skill levels and preferences. These routes explore the diverse landscapes of the Westerwald district.
The Marienrachdorf area, part of the Westerwald, features varied terrain ideal for road cycling. You'll encounter green forests, rolling hills, and picturesque river valleys, such as along the Nister. This provides a mix of moderate paths and more challenging rides with significant elevation gains.
Yes, for those seeking a challenge, the region offers routes with considerable elevation. An example is the difficult Wiedbahn Tunnel and Bridge – Burg Ehrenstein Ruins loop from Maroth, which covers 73.3 km with over 950 meters of ascent.
Yes, there are easy routes perfect for beginners or those looking for a more relaxed ride. For instance, the Deesen Town Center loop from Krümmel is an easy 21.7 km route with around 270 meters of elevation gain.
Many routes offer scenic views and pass by notable landmarks. You can cycle past the Dreifelder Pond and its wooden boardwalks, or enjoy a view over the Dreifelder Weiher towards Seeburg. The region also features impressive cultural sites like Schloss Hachenburg and the ruins of Burg Ehrenstein.
Yes, many of the road cycling routes around Marienrachdorf are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ish in the same location. Examples include the Dreifelder Weiher – Drei-Kirchen-Kreuz loop from Goddert and the Schloss Hachenburg – Dreifelder Weiher loop from Herschbach.
The spring and summer months are particularly recommended for road cycling in Marienrachdorf. During this time, you can fully appreciate the region's natural charm, with green forests and pleasant weather conditions.
The road cycling routes in Marienrachdorf are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.8 stars from over 100 reviews. Cyclists often praise the varied terrain, scenic beauty, and the well-paved surfaces found throughout the Westerwald region.
Absolutely. The region is known for its idyllic ponds, such as the Dreifelder Weiher. Routes like the Dreifelder Weiher – Drei-Kirchen-Kreuz loop from Goddert and the Schloss Hachenburg – Dreifelder Weiher loop from Herschbach will take you past these beautiful water features.
Yes, several routes incorporate historical sites. For example, the Sayntal – View of Isenburg Castle loop from Marienrachdorf offers views of Isenburg Castle, and the Schloss Hachenburg – Dreifelder Weiher loop from Herschbach passes by the impressive Schloss Hachenburg.
The routes vary significantly in length to suit different preferences. You can find shorter rides, such as the 21.7 km Deesen Town Center loop from Krümmel, up to longer, more demanding tours like the 73.3 km Wiedbahn Tunnel and Bridge – Burg Ehrenstein Ruins loop from Maroth.
